Ashley Arnoldt has found her heart horse in Light My Fire, affectionately known as “Lenny.” Their deep connection paid off Thursday during the Odlum Brown BC Open at Thunderbird Show Park with a decisive win in the $25,000 Forest Edge Farm USHJA International Hunter Derby.
Arnoldt, a three-time champion of the Canadian Hunter Derby Series, drew on her extensive experience with the 13-year-old Hanoverian stallion to deliver a polished performance. Despite an early draw—fourth in the order—she stuck to her plan and executed flawlessly.
“My strategy today was to have a smooth round,” said the Langley-based rider. “We don’t do a lot of international derbies, but qualifying for Derby Finals is a goal for this year and next. If I felt good, I wanted to jump the high options. I think I might have been the only one to jump the high option for the split rails—he nailed it. I knew he was there to play today.”
The judges rewarded Lenny’s determination, smoothness, and boldness with a winning score of 363. Chocotoff and Morgan Thomas claimed second (360.5) for Robert Fries, while Oxo Van de Bien and Allison Lagan secured third (353.25) for Joanne Dixon.
Derbies are Lenny’s forte. “He’s done so many,” Arnoldt said. “In the last couple of years, he’s been consistent. Normally, we’re always second—that’s our signature. So we don’t necessarily always win every class, but we’ve always been [at least] second or third.”
Originally a show jumper, Lenny has thrived in his hunter career. “He’s very chill, very quiet. Sometimes he can wake up in the ring a little bit,” she shared. “He has just enough spice to jump those high options and still respect them—and he always gives his best.”
Consistency, Arnoldt says, is the secret to their success.
“He’s so good,” she continued. “At first he wasn’t handy, so handy turns were very hard. And now he looks for them. He tries so hard. We know each other so well, so now we just finesse it.”
Arnoldt knows Lenny is a once-in-a-lifetime partner.
“He is a horse of a lifetime for me,” she said of Lenny. “I don’t know if I’ll ever be so lucky to have another horse with this kind of achievement. He’s done so much and he owes me nothing. He just has to go be himself and do what he does best.”
$25,000 Forest Edge Farm USHJA International Hunter Derby
Horse / Rider / Owner / Score
1. Light My Fire / Ashley Arnoldt / Jennifer Arnoldt / 363
2. Chocotoff / Morgan Thomas / Robert Fries / 360.5
3. Oxo Van de Bien / Allison Lagan / Joanne Dixon / 353.25
4. Pac Man TW / Amara Gottwald / Amara Gottwald / 331
5. Closing Time / Kelsey King / Kelsey King / 329
